Identifying Components for Remote Control Unit

After the speaker setup, it is required to make Remote Con-
trol unit capable of identifying the devices it controls. Re-
mote Control unit provided with the receiver can be used
in setup of any device. Even when a device is not listed in
the device codes in the Remote Control unit memory, the
remote control function of the device can be programmed
using the Learn function.

The Learn function can also be used to extend the remote
controllable functions.

For details, see “If a device cannot be remote controlled with
any code in the list, or to add remote control target func-
tions...” on page 40.
